What external drive should I use for External Drive Editing? (iOS)

The External Drive Editing function works best with SSDs at 1050 Mbps or higher read speeds and only works with USB-C or a Thunderbolt 3 connection. We do not recommend using a hard disk drive (HDD) with LumaFusion. For additional information on this feature, please review the following reference guide page: External Drive Editing from USB-C


If you have access to a computer, we strongly recommend that you reformat your drive to APFS before using it in LumaFusion. You can find out more on how to format an external SSD in the Apple support page here.
